Fast and low overhead web framework, for Node.js | Fastify
Fastify.io 是一个关于 Fastify 的网站,Fastify 是一个用 TypeScript 编写的 Node.js Web 框架。它以快速和可扩展而闻名,支持各种插件和中间件。 Fastify.io 网站提供了有关 Fastify 的全面信息,包括: * 文档:Fastify.io 提供了全面的文档,涵盖了 Fastify 的各个方面,如安装、路由、中间件、错误处理等。 * 教程:Fastify.io 提供了丰富的教程,帮助新手快速入门 Fastify,并学习如何使用 Fastify 构建各种 Web 应用。 * 社区:Fastify.io 有一个活跃的社区,用户可以在其中提问、分享经验和参与讨论。 * 插件和中间件:Fastify.io 列出了各种可用于 Fastify 的插件和中间件,帮助用户扩展 Fastify 的功能。 * 演示:Fastify.io 提供了几个演示,展示了 Fastify 的强大功能和灵活性。 Fastify.io 是学习和使用 Fastify 的绝佳资源,它提供了全面的文档、教程、社区支持和示例,帮助用户快速上手 Fastify,并构建出色的 Web 应用。
Express - Node.js web application framework
Expressjs.com 是一个 Web 开发框架 Express.js 的官方网站。Express.js 是一个基于 Node.js 的 Web 应用框架,提供了许多功能和工具来帮助开发人员快速构建和部署 Web 应用。 Expressjs.com 网站提供了 Express.js 的详细文档,包括如何安装、使用和配置 Express.js,以及如何使用 Express.js 构建各种类型的 Web 应用。网站还提供了 Express.js 的 API 文档、教程和示例代码,以帮助开发人员学习和使用 Express.js。 此外,Expressjs.com 网站还提供了 Express.js 社区的相关信息,包括论坛、博客和社交媒体账号,方便开发人员与其他 Express.js 用户互动交流。 访问 Expressjs.com 网站,您可以获取有关 Express.js 的最新信息,并获得所需的资源和支持来构建您的 Web 应用。
JSHint, a JavaScript Code Quality Tool
jshint.com是一个在线JavaScript代码质量检查工具,由Anatoli Kaspersky创建。它可以帮助开发者快速检查JavaScript代码中的错误,并提供修复建议。它支持多种JavaScript语法,包括ES6+。 jshint.com的使用非常简单,只要将JavaScript代码粘贴到网站上,点击“JSHint”按钮,就能看到代码中的错误和警告。错误会以红色突出显示,警告会以黄色突出显示。 jshint.com提供了多种配置选项,允许开发者根据需要自定义检查规则。例如,开发者可以禁用某些规则,或设置规则的严重性。 jshint.com是一个非常有用的工具,可以帮助开发者快速检查JavaScript代码中的错误,并提供修复建议。它对于提高JavaScript代码的质量非常有帮助。 以下是jshint.com的一些主要功能: * 检查JavaScript代码中的错误和警告 * 提供修复建议 * 支持多种JavaScript语法,包括ES6+ * 提供多种配置选项,允许开发者自定义检查规则 * 完全免费
简数代码 | JShare
JSshare.com.cn是一个免费的网络资源共享平台,专注于分享和下载各种实用工具、资源素材、教程文档、设计模板、源码程序等。网站提供海量资源,涵盖各种领域和主题,包括但不限于: * **实用工具:**包括各种转换工具、在线工具、系统工具、安全工具等,帮助用户解决日常工作和生活中的各种问题。 * **资源素材:**包括各种图片素材、视频素材、音频素材、字体素材、图标素材等,为设计师、自媒体人和创作者提供丰富的素材资源。 * **教程文档:**包括各种编程教程、设计教程、摄影教程、办公教程等,帮助用户快速掌握各种技能和知识。 * **设计模板:**包括各种平面设计模板、网页设计模板、PPT模板、海报模板等,为设计人员提供丰富的模板资源。 * **源码程序:**包括各种开源软件源码、示例代码、程序脚本等,为开发人员提供学习和参考资源。 JSshare.com.cn的资源全部经过严格筛选和审核,确保资源的质量和安全性。同时,网站还提供强大的搜索功能和分类导航,帮助用户快速找到所需的资源。
anime.js • JavaScript animation engine
AnimeJS 是一个易于使用的 JavaScript 动画库,它可以帮助您创建流畅、高效的动画。AnimeJS 提供了广泛的动画选项,包括基本动画、缓动函数、动画控制、时间线控制等。您还可以使用 AnimeJS 创建自定义动画,并控制动画的每一个细节。 AnimeJS 非常适合创建 Web 动画、游戏动画、数据可视化动画等。它可以帮助您轻松实现复杂的动画效果,并让您的项目更加生动有趣。 AnimeJS 是一个轻量级的 JavaScript 库,它只有 20KB 左右。它非常易于使用,并且有详细的文档和示例代码。您可以在 AnimeJS 的官方网站上找到更多信息。 以下是一些使用 AnimeJS 创建的动画示例: * 一个带有缓动效果的按钮动画 * 一个移动和旋转的元素动画 * 一个带有时间线控制的动画 * 一个带有自定义动画效果的动画 如果您正在寻找一个简单易用、功能强大的 JavaScript 动画库,那么 AnimeJS 是一个非常不错的选择。
CSS & JavaScript Toolbox | CSS, JS, PHP, HTML WordPress Plugin
CSS-JS-Toolbox.com是一个免费的在线工具集,用于网页设计和开发。它提供了一系列易于使用的工具来帮助你设计和开发更美观、更交互的网页。 该网站提供多种工具,包括: * **颜色选择器:**用于选择网页元素的颜色。 * **字体选择器:**用于选择网页元素的字体。 * **CSS生成器:**用于生成CSS代码。 * **JavaScript生成器:**用于生成JavaScript代码。 * **响应式设计测试仪:**用于测试网页的响应式设计。 * **图像优化工具:**用于优化网页图像。 * **网页加载速度测试工具:**用于测试网页的加载速度。 CSS-JS-Toolbox.com是一个非常有用的在线工具集,可以帮助你设计和开发更美观、更交互的网页。它提供了多种易于使用的工具,非常适合网页设计师和开发人员使用。 **优点:** * 免费使用 * 提供多种易于使用的工具 * 非常适合网页设计师和开发人员使用
.NET, Xamarin, JavaScript, Angular UI components | Syncfusion
Syncfusion.com是一个提供企业软件解决方案的网站。该网站提供各种各样的软件产品,包括商业智能、数据分析、报表、电子表格、PDF、图表、移动应用程序开发、人工智能和机器学习。这些产品可以帮助企业提高效率、降低成本并做出更好的决策。 Syncfusion.com的软件产品具有以下特点: * 易于使用:Syncfusion的软件产品设计合理,易于使用。即使是非技术人员也可以轻松上手。 * 功能强大:Syncfusion的软件产品功能强大,可以满足企业各种各样的需求。 * 可扩展性强:Syncfusion的软件产品可扩展性强,可以随着企业的发展而不断扩展。 * 性价比高:Syncfusion的软件产品性价比高,可以帮助企业节省成本。 除了软件产品外,Syncfusion.com还提供各种各样的服务,包括咨询、培训和支持。这些服务可以帮助企业快速部署和使用Syncfusion的软件产品,并解决企业在使用过程中遇到的各种问题。 Syncfusion.com是一家备受认可的软件公司。其软件产品被全球超过100万家企业使用。Syncfusion的软件产品还获得了许多奖项,包括微软Visual Studio行业合作伙伴奖、红鲱鱼100强奖和德勤高科技高增长500强奖。
A safe and modern home for JavaScript technologies | OpenJS Foundation
js.foundation 是一个由 JavaScript 社区维护的网站,旨在帮助学习、构建和分享有关 JavaScript 的知识。它包含了大量的文章、教程和代码示例,涵盖了 JavaScript 的各个方面,从基本语法到高级特性。 该网站分为多个部分: * **学习:** 这个部分提供了有关 JavaScript 的基本知识,包括变量、数据类型、函数、对象等。还有一些关于更高级主题的文章,例如异步编程和函数式编程。 * **构建:** 这个部分提供了有关如何使用 JavaScript 构建 Web 应用的教程。其中包括如何使用 HTML、CSS 和 JavaScript 来创建交互式网站和应用程序。 * **分享:** 这个部分提供了有关如何贡献 JavaScript 社区的文章。其中包括如何编写技术文章、开展开源项目以及参加会议。 js.foundation 网站是学习 JavaScript 的一个很好的资源。它提供了大量高质量的文章和教程,涵盖了 JavaScript 的各个方面。该网站还积极鼓励社区参与,并为贡献者提供了许多机会。
A safe and modern home for JavaScript technologies | OpenJS Foundation
jQuery.org 是 jQuery 项目的官方网站。jQuery 是一个免费、开放源代码的 JavaScript 库,旨在简化 HTML DOM 的操作、事件处理和动画。 **jQuery.org 网站的主要功能包括:** * **下载 jQuery 库**:您可以从网站下载最新版本的 jQuery 库,并将其添加到您的项目中。 * **查看文档**:网站提供了完整的 jQuery 文档,其中包括教程、示例和 API 参考。 * **获得支持**:如果您在使用 jQuery 时遇到问题,您可以通过网站上的论坛或邮件列表寻求帮助。 * **参与社区**:您可以通过网站上的论坛、邮件列表或 IRC 频道加入 jQuery 社区,与其他 jQuery 开发者交流经验。 jQuery.org 网站是一个非常有用的资源,它可以帮助您学习和使用 jQuery 库。
NestJS - A progressive Node.js framework
NestJS 是一个用于构建高效、可扩展的 Node.js 应用程序的框架。它采用模块化设计、基于 TypeScript 语言,并遵循严格的依赖注入原则。NestJS 提供了丰富的功能,包括: * **模块化设计:** NestJS 采用模块化设计,将应用程序划分成多个独立的模块,从而提高代码的可维护性和可重用性。 * **依赖注入:** NestJS 遵循依赖注入原则,通过注入器将依赖项传递给组件,从而提高代码的可测试性和可维护性。 * **路由管理:** NestJS 提供了强大的路由管理功能,支持各种路由方式,如 GET、POST、PUT、DELETE 等。 * **视图引擎:** NestJS 支持多种视图引擎,如 Pug、Handlebars、EJS 等,可以轻松地渲染 HTML 页面。 * **数据验证:** NestJS 提供了数据验证功能,可以对请求参数、响应体等进行验证,从而提高应用程序的健壮性。 * **错误处理:** NestJS 提供了错误处理中间件,可以捕获和处理应用程序中的错误,从而提高应用程序的稳定性。 NestJS 是一个功能强大、易于使用的 Node.js 框架,非常适合构建高效、可扩展的应用程序。
UmiJS - 插件化的企业级前端应用框架
umijs.org 是一个用于构建企业级前端应用的框架,它集成了众多先进的技术,例如 React、Redux、Dva、Ant Design 等,并提供了一系列开箱即用的特性,例如路由管理、状态管理、数据请求、国际化、主题切换等,还可以使用 umijs 插件系统来扩展其功能。 umijs 的主要特点包括: * **开箱即用:** umijs 提供了一系列开箱即用的特性,例如路由管理、状态管理、数据请求、国际化、主题切换等,减少了开发人员的重复劳动。 * **灵活可扩展:** umijs 使用插件系统来扩展其功能,开发者可以根据自己的需求安装和使用插件。 * **强大的社区支持:** umijs 拥有一个活跃的社区,开发者可以在社区中寻求帮助和分享经验。 umijs 非常适合构建企业级的前端应用,特别是那些需要快速开发、灵活扩展、复杂度较高的应用。目前,umijs 已被广泛应用于众多企业和组织中,例如阿里巴巴、蚂蚁金服、腾讯、京东、百度等。 如果你需要构建一个企业级的前端应用,那么 umijs 是一个非常好的选择。你可以访问 umijs.org 官网了解更多信息,或者在 GitHub 上查看 umijs 的源代码。